Kia Ray Plug-In Hybrid Concept review in Chicago Motor Show (CMS) 2010

Kia releases official Ray newest concept cars, in the event Chicago Motor Show (CMS) in 2010, in Chicago, United States (U.S.).

2010 Kia Ray who has a futuristic design uses a hybrid system of plug-ins that can accommodate four people in the cabin. This car can drive up to 80.5 km range using electric power alone. Kia Ray also claims the fuel-efficient 1.2-liter gasoline consumption for the 100km distance.
Ray shared platform with the Kia Forte-gari the aerodynamic body lines. Design Addons mono-volume shape gives the impression aggressive on this car like a snake. Very important as the process of designing this car for the future and green respective. Being green is Kia’s commitment to combine the modern and caring environment. Ray brought 1.4L direct injection engine and 78 kW electric motor capable of achieving maximum power 153 hp (114 kW) through the transmission continuously variable transmission (CVT).
